”Find out the night of glory in the last Ashra of Ramadan’ which means the last odd ten days of Ramadan.” remarked Prophet Hazrat Mohammad (ﷺ).

“We sent down the Quran in the night of glory,” reads the first verse, widely known as Laylatul Qadr or Shab e Qadar. Surah Qadr is the 97th Surah of the Holy Quran, and it contains five verses that discuss the significance of the lovely night.
